About Davenstedt
Davenstedt is a town located in Germany, in the Lower Saxony region. With a recorded population of 10,666, it is home to a diverse community of residents.
Geographically, Davenstedt lies at coordinates 52.37°N, 9.67°E, placing it in the Northern Eastern Hemisphere. The city operates on the Europe/Berlin timezone, which governs daily life and business hours for its inhabitants.
